Three hundred years have passed since colonists from Earth settled on Alpha Centauri IV. Since that time, the colony has thrived under the watchful eye of the Stark Corporation and the governing body known as the Terran Union, with its cities rivalling those on Luna, the moon of Earth, now known as Terra. However, rumours are spreading that Henry Stark, head of the Stark Corporation, is not all he claims to be...

Ok, some further background on this: It's in our own universe, set somewhere around 2463, in which humanity has terraformed the entire solar system, with the exception of the gas giants, and colonised them. To compensate for the long time it takes to travel, even at the speed of light, humans made use of an ancient alien technology they call the Bending Gates, which bend the space-time continuum to allow for near-instantaneous travel between two such gates. Scientists later combined this technology with humanity's own lightspeed propulsion to travel somewhat faster than light. Prior to this, humans sent cyrogenically frozen workers in Sleeper Pods wth the material to build a single Bending Gate, to send terraformers and colonists to each planet. For characters, you may come up with anything for homeworld, though following terraformation, Mercury has been made into a prison world, where convicts are sent to serve their sentence, so I doubt anyone would be born there.
